Environmentally Conscious Materials Selection

With the increasing demand for groundbreaking architectural concepts, the selection of eco-friendly materials has become critical in reducing environmental impact. Architects increasingly prioritize materials that are locally sourced, renewable, and recyclable. This method not only decreases the carbon footprint associated with transport but also strengthens local economic growth. Materials such as bamboo, salvaged timber, and recycled metals are rising in demand for their strength and attractive appearance. In addition, the application of low-VOC coatings and finishes supports improved indoor air quality. Through the incorporation of sustainable materials in their projects, architects can design environments that are both functional and uplifting but also environmentally responsible, cultivating a sustainability-focused culture within the constructed environment.

Eco-Friendly Design Approaches

The incorporation of eco-friendly materials effectively enhances sustainable design methods in architecture. These approaches are centered on minimizing energy usage while enhancing occupant comfort. Architects frequently highlight passive solar design techniques, maximizing natural light and ventilation to minimize reliance on artificial systems. Thoughtful positioning of windows, awnings, and thermal mass elements can considerably decrease energy demands for heating and cooling. Additionally, utilizing advanced insulation and efficient HVAC technology guarantees that buildings maintain ideal temperatures with reduced energy consumption. Utilizing renewable energy sources, such as solar panels, additionally enhances a structure's overall sustainability. At its core, energy-efficient design practices not only reduce environmental impact but also encourage lasting financial benefits, responding to the rising interest in thoughtful and progressive design solutions.

Eco-Friendly Building Certifications

As sustainable architecture continues to gain momentum, green building certifications have established themselves as key benchmarks for measuring environmental impact. Such certifications, including LEED, BREEAM, and the Living Building Challenge, deliver structured guidelines for assessing energy efficiency, water conservation, and materials sustainability. They inspire architects to embrace forward-thinking design strategies that reduce environmental impact while improving occupant well-being. By fulfilling demanding requirements, projects not only attain recognition but also establish a competitive position in the market. Additionally, green certifications commonly generate long-term cost reductions through decreased energy consumption and enhanced operational efficiency. In the end, these certifications act as a foundational guide for architects striving to design spaces that are both practical and environmentally responsible, promoting a more sustainable future in the built environment.

Modern Trends in Architectural Design Services

Recent advancements in technology and sustainability are shaping the direction of architectural design services. Design professionals are embedding smart technologies into their designs, leveraging data-driven analytics and automation to enhance functionality and efficiency. Building Information Modeling (BIM) has established itself as a foundational resource, facilitating accurate visualization and seamless collaboration throughout the project lifecycle.

Eco-friendly design approaches are increasingly coming to the forefront, with building professionals concentrating on low-energy materials and clean energy alternatives. The growing trend of biophilic design highlights the relationship between the natural world and constructed spaces, fostering improved health and enhanced efficiency.

Furthermore, adaptable and versatile spaces are increasingly sought after, accommodating changing needs and lifestyles. The increasing adoption of remote work has transformed residential and commercial architectural approaches, giving rise to versatile spaces that emphasize both functionality and comfort. Taken together, these trends underscore a strong commitment to innovative, sustainable, and user-focused design in present-day architectural endeavors.

What Are the Standard Project Delivery Methods in Architecture?

Prevalent project delivery methods in the field of architecture include Construction Management at Risk, Design-Bid-Build, Design-Build, and Integrated Project Delivery. Each of these methods presents unique benefits, impacting collaboration, timelines, and overall costs across the entire project lifecycle.
